Default One-time P0420

Cam install, one week later: while driving in the rain today, I got a check engine light while cruising gently uphill: P0420 set, another P0420 pending. I cleared the codes to see if they would return, and they didn't. The code means that I either have a massive exhaust leak, my rear O2 sensors are showing too little change, or my cat is dying.

(Less than a month before my emissions test, and I get my very first emissions-related CEL. It figures.)

Here'* what I've looked at and what I plan to do:
  • I've noticed no loss of top speed or power, so I'm guessing my cat is fine. Last time I gave it a good knocking (during the cam install), nothing rattled.
  • I reused the exhaust pipe gasket when reinstalling the engine, because it was in good shape and not flattened. I'll replace that the next chance I get.
  • I checked the fuel trims and the voltages of the O2 sensors at idle and while cruising (25-35 mph), but that was pointless, seeing as how I don't know how to interpret the data.

Anything else I should check out?

Sure..first thing is list the code description.
Ok, I'll do it, but keep in mind it'* your responsibility.

Catalyst below efficiency. This means the difference between the reading on the front and rear O2'* doesn't have enough of a difference. Aka your whacking could have broken up the honeycomb and screwed up your cat.

By "a good knocking," I meant a few taps with my bare knuckles. If that'* enough to do it, find some Kryptonite.

Grabbed my scanner and went out to the highway last night. Did a couple WOT pulls while watching the intake manifold pressure, which fluctuated as it normally should. That rules out a blockage. I'm going to follow the GM eSI P0420 troubleshooting today to see if the cat is flowing but dead.
